Hi there -- We are looking at going with a Bluestar rangetop (RGTNB486GV2) in our new build. The only concern we have - and cannot get a solid answer from the manufacturer or anyone else - is if it will work with our backsplash. We want to use quartzite slab as the backsplash which at 3cm is thicker than standard wall tile. the bluestar claims it needs 24" to install and with the quartzite backsplash will only have 23.8 inches. Will this still work? Anyone have experience with this?
